Check your Pressure as well as Temperature Level Shutoffs
Your water heater's temperature as well as stress shutoffs manage the temperature and pressure within the water heater storage tank. These shutoffs will certainly prevent an explosion if your storage tank gets as well warm or if the pressure surpasses safe degrees.
Unfortunately, these safety devices provide no warning when they spoil. You can validate your shutoff's effectiveness by holding on to the valve's lever. If it remains in good condition, water needs to spurt. If no water spurts or only a trickle is released, hurry as well as obtain your shutoffs dealt with.

Constantly pre-programmed the optimum temperature level
Warm water burns in the house prevail. You can protect against crashes, conserve power and also respect the setting merely by presetting your hot water heater's optimum temperature. The most convenient hot water temperature is 120F. Water at this temperature level is secure for grownups, kids, as well as the elderly.

Tips to Increase the Lifespan of your Water Heater
Turn OFF the geyser when not in use
Turn the geyser off when you are done using it. It will help decrease power consumption, extend lifespan, and save money on water heater repair. The water does not turn cold, even after switching the geyser off, as the storage tank holds the temperature of the water for 4-5 hours.
Proper Installation
Proper space should be left around the water heater. It should not feel crowded, and giving room to breathe increases airflow and reduces the risk of fires. This gives you optimal space for completing routine system maintenance checks without difficulty. Nothing should be kept near or under the geyser. The geyser should be installed away from wet areas, like the bathtub, shower, or toilet.
Insulate your Water Heater
Insulation should be installed around the pipes and the water heater to make it more energy efficient and to increase the water temperature by 2-4 degrees. During the summertime, this keeps the pipes from sweating or forming condensation. It can also protect your cold water pipes from freezing and potentially bursting during cooler months. Insulation may cut heat loss by as much as 45% and your expenditures for overheating the water.
Replace the Sacrificial Anode
Water heaters are equipped with a sacrificial anode to prevent corrosion by hard water. The anode rod protects the tank from rusting on the inside and should be checked yearly. Without a rod or a properly functioning anode rod, the hot water quickly corrodes inside the tank. It can last anywhere from five to ten years. However, the amount of water you use and the hardness of your water determines its need for replacement.
Install a Water Softener
f you live in an area where the mineral content is high in the water systems, then installing a water softener might help expand the lifespan of your water heater. When an area has high mineral content (calcium and magnesium) in the water, it’s known as hard water. Hard water leaves deposits to form at the bottom of the water heater, which causes them to have problems much sooner than expected. To prevent this from happening, install a water softener that filters out the minerals that make the water hard, allowing only soft water to flow through the pipes.
Lower the Temperature
Lowering the temperature of your geyser will help you save electricity, increase its life, and the geyser will have to work less. Maintaining a temperature of 120 degrees Fahrenheit to eradicate the vast majority of pathogens is a good thumb rule. The hotter your hot water supply is, the more energy it will consume.
